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
33961218 888 46312662335 3309660899 64503
154111 4529
154111 4529
5917 8217377 7263958431
All about undefined
Interested in learning more?
154111 4529
5917 8217377 7263958431
See more
3833986 3113490
03885 8960165543 799
See more
7565593306 89204013
7255 1640460 57 43868696 705
See more